India’s Miracle Healing
My little 17 year old dog India has cataracts that rendered her almost completely blind. The vet told us a couple of years ago that India could only see shadows and she would eventually be completely blind. This was devastating news as India’s greatest joy was chasing balls endlessly. All of that came to a…